NXP Semiconductors N.V. announced that Sir Peter Bonfield, the Founding Chairman of NXP, has retired from his service on the NXP Board as of the conclusion of the company's 2023 Annual General Meeting of shareholders. The Board of Directors of NXP has appointed Ms. Julie Southern to serve as its Chair, effective immediately. At the AGM, shareholders overwhelmingly elected all nominated directors to the Company's Board of Directors, including Mr. Moshe Gavrielov, who joins the Board as a non-executive director. Sir Peter Bonfield has served as Chairman of NXP since NXPs spin-out from Philips in 2006. In his seventeen
years of service as NXPs Founding Chairman, Sir Peter has been instrumental in leading NXP through its significant and successful transformation. Ms. Julie Southern, who has now assumed the role of Chair of the Board, has been a non-executive director of the board since October 2013 and the Chair of the audit committee since September 2018. Mr. Gavrielov served as president and CEO of Xilinx Inc. from January 2008 to January 2018 and as director of Xilinx Inc. from February 2008 to January 2018. Prior to that, he served at Cadence Design Systems Inc. as executive vice president and general manager of the verification division from April 2005 to November 2007, and CEO of Versity Ltd. from March 1998 to April 2005. He also served at a variety of executive management positions in LSI Logic Corp. for nearly 10 years, and engineering and engineering management positions in National Semiconductor Corporation and Digital Equipment Corporation. Since 2019, Mr. Gavrielov has served on the board of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company Limited. In addition, Mr. Gavrielov is the chairman of SiMa Technologies Inc. and Foretellix Ltd. Mr. Gavrielov holds a bachelor's degree in electrical engineering and a master's degree in computer science from Technion-Israel Institute of Technology.
